Seibert v. Hooks
Petitioner: Steven Jacob Seibert
Respondent: Brad Hooks
Case Number: 1:2010cv01323
Filed: April 30, 2010
Court: US District Court for the Northern District of Georgia
Office: Atlanta Office
County: Tattnall
Presiding Judge: Julie E. Carnes
Nature of Suit: Habeas Corpus (General)
Cause of Action: 28 U.S.C. ยง 2254
Jury Demanded By: None

March 11, 2013 Opinion or Order Filing 146 ORDER AND OPINION adopting the 142 Magistrate's Report and Recommendation denying as moot petitioners request for relief 133 and denying without prejudice petitioners post-appeal pro se motions [119, 127, 128, 131, 135, 138, and 139]. The Court determines that the time for reopening petitioners appeal, pursuant to FED. R. APP. P. 4(a)(6), should be granted, this date. Petitioner may file a notice of appeal within 14 days of the entry of this Order, pursuant to FED. R. APP. P. 4(a)(6). Signed by Judge Julie E. Carnes on 3/11/13. (ddm)
